Of course, Rudolph wouldn't be the same without his trusty antlers. Those pointy protrusions make him instantly recognizable and add to his overall charm. But did you know that male reindeer actually shed their antlers every year? That means that Rudolph technically shouldn't have those antlers all year round. But hey, who needs realism when you have holiday magic?

Who is Rudolph and why is he famous?
Rudolph is a famous reindeer who is known for his red nose. He is part of Santa Claus' team of reindeers who help him deliver gifts to children all around the world during Christmas Eve.
What does Rudolph look like in images?
Rudolph is usually depicted as a cute and adorable reindeer with a bright red nose. In images, he is shown with antlers, a brown fur coat, and a red collar around his neck.
